What does 'sunset tells the story' mean?
1 answer
2024-11-30 03:10
Well, 'sunset tells the story' can be seen from an artistic point of view. Artists often use sunsets in their works to tell various stories. It could be a story of love, as the warm colors of the sunset can create a romantic atmosphere. It might also be a story of change, because the setting sun marks the change from day to night. In literature, too, a sunset can be a powerful symbol that sets the mood for a story, whether it's a story of hope, despair, or something in between. The way the light fades, the colors blend, all these elements work together to tell a unique story.

Is Sunset Boulevard a true story?
1 answer
2024-10-08 16:52
Sunset Boulevard is purely fictional. It was crafted by the imagination of the writers and filmmakers to present a compelling narrative rather than being based on real events or people.

Dusk referred to the time after sunset until the sky was not completely dark, and sunset referred to the process of the sun slowly setting below the western horizon. Dusk was after sunset, but the sky was not completely dark. Sunset was when the sun began to set. These two words had different meanings and time nodes.
